A solar panel PCB is a specialized circuit board designed to connect solar cells and control power distribution. Unlike ordinary PCBs, it must handle higher power loads, outdoor exposure, and long-term reliability requirements. These PCBs are the backbone of solar energy systems, ensuring that. . Photovoltaic (PV) cells convert sunlight directly into electricity through the photovoltaic effect. These cells generate an electric. . Solar PCBs are adapting and advancing more by including new elements such as MPPT (Maximum Power Point Tracking) circuit boards and IoT sensors that improve energy efficiency and add the capacity to monitor energy consumption.
